First of all, radio stations already have to compensate composers for every
song that they play over the airwaves.   It hardly seems unreasonable to me
that Internet Radio Stations should be required to pay similar
compensation.   This compensation should not be based on revenues, but on
listenership - the same as other performance licenses.  Quite simply, there
is no right for internet radiobroadcasters to make money by broadcasting
others' intellectual property without compensation.
